    NEED HELP? LEAVE THE TECH TO US LIVE 24/7 CHAPTER 2: OVERVIEW TECHNICAL SUPPORT 1.877.877.2269 2. OVERVIEW 2.1 INTRODUCTION The 4Site II represents the latest state-of-the-art technology in keyboard-video-mouse (KVM) switching. The key advantage of the 4Site II over conventional KVM switches is that it allows you to simultaneously display and manage four computers on a single console. It combines features of a high-end KVM switch and a digital multiviewer, scaling and converting videos at both inputs and output.

  • Page 26 NEED HELP? LEAVE THE TECH TO US LIVE 24/7 CHAPTER 5: ON-SCREEN DISPLAY (OSD) TECHNICAL SUPPORT 1.877.877.2269 There are two DCP modes: Š DCP control, which allows external control of the display mode. Š Š DCP synchronize, which keeps several 4Site II devices in the same display mode. Š...
  • Page 27 NEED HELP? LEAVE THE TECH TO US LIVE 24/7 CHAPTER 5: ON-SCREEN DISPLAY (OSD) TECHNICAL SUPPORT 1.877.877.2269 DCP synchronize Use this mode to keep several 4Site II devices in the same mode. Every change in settings initiated in the first 4Site II by hotkeys, hotmouse, front-panel buttons or a controlling devices synchronizes the modes of all connected devices via DCP messages.
  • Page 28: Osd - Mode - Current/Start

    NEED HELP? LEAVE THE TECH TO US LIVE 24/7 CHAPTER 5: ON-SCREEN DISPLAY (OSD) TECHNICAL SUPPORT 1.877.877.2269 To synchronize, 4Site II 1 sends every change in settings as a DCP message via the serial Y to the RX input of 4Site II 2. 4Site II 2 adopts the settings and sends a DCP message via TX output over the Y cable to the RX input of 4Site II 3.
